Ensuring Transmission Quality and Reliability

So, you’ve found a potential transmission. Now what? You need to make sure it’s not going to give you grief down the road. Ask for proof of testing. Reputable sellers will have records showing the transmission was checked for leaks, smooth shifting, and overall condition. Don’t be shy about asking questions – what car did it come from? How many kilometers did it have? Was it replaced due to a fault or just an upgrade?

When buying used, especially for performance, it’s wise to get a professional opinion. A mechanic can sometimes spot potential issues before you buy, or at least advise on what to look for. This extra step can save you a lot of headaches and money later on.

Here are some things to check:

  • Visual Inspection: Look for any obvious damage, cracks, or signs of leaks around seals.
  • Fluid Condition: If possible, check the transmission fluid. It should be clean and not smell burnt.

Understanding Transmission Compatibility

This is where things can get tricky. Not all automatic transmissions are created equal, even if they look similar. You need to make sure the transmission you’re buying is compatible with your car’s make, model, year, and even engine size. A transmission from a 2010 Holden Commodore might not bolt straight into a 2015 model, for example. It’s always best to get the VIN of the car the transmission came from, if possible. If you’re unsure, a good mechanic or the parts supplier can help you figure out what will fit. Don’t guess on this; it’s a costly mistake to make.

Signs Your Transmission Needs Attention

So, how do you know if your automatic transmission is on its last legs? It’s not always a sudden breakdown. Sometimes, it’s a slow decline. You might notice things like the car hesitating when you try to accelerate, or maybe it feels like it’s slipping out of gear when you’re driving. Weird noises, like grinding or whining, are also a big red flag. And don’t forget about leaks – if you see reddish fluid under your car, that’s usually transmission fluid, and it’s definitely not good.

Here are some common signs to watch out for:

  • Rough or jerky gear changes.
  • Delayed engagement when shifting into drive or reverse.
  • A burning smell, especially during operation.
  • Unusual noises like humming, clunking, or whining.
  • Transmission fluid leaks (often red or brown and sticky).
  • Check engine light or transmission warning light illuminated.

Repair vs. Replacement Decisions

When your transmission starts acting up, the big question is: fix it or ditch it? If the problem is minor, like a faulty sensor or a small leak, a repair might be the way to go. It can save you some cash. But, if the internal parts are seriously damaged – think worn-out clutches, damaged gears, or a busted torque converter – then replacing the whole unit is often the smarter move. A full rebuild can get expensive, sometimes costing almost as much as a good used transmission. It really comes down to the extent of the damage and what makes the most financial sense for your car. Long-Term Reliability of Tested Transmissions

A common worry is that used parts won’t last as long or work as well as new ones. But honestly, that’s often not the case, especially with transmissions. Many used transmissions come from cars that were taken off the road for reasons totally unrelated to the transmission itself, like an accident. These parts can still have plenty of life left in them. The trick is to get them from places that check them out. Reputable auto wreckers will test their transmissions to make sure they’re in good shape before selling them. This means you can get a reliable part that’s been checked and is ready to go, often at a much lower price than a brand-new one. It’s about finding a trusted source for these components.
